Measures for Improving Surface Integrity in Grinding

How grinding conditions affect surface layer properties and impact fatigue resistance, wear resistance, and stress corrosion resistance.

Abstract

The combined influence of mechanical and thermal loading during the grinding process affects the properties of the workpiece surface layers, which can significantly reduce resistance to fatigue, wear, and stress corrosion.

In recent years, increasing attention has been paid to the interaction between grinding conditions and the surface integrity of the ground part. Due to lack of sufficient information on this subject, the grinding operation is sometimes avoided for critical parts.

Critical Application Example

The finding that vital parts, such as aircraft landing gear, failed prematurely as a result of incorrectly applied grinding conditions is certainly not unrelated to this concern.
